摘要:Data Matrix codes can be a significant factor in increasing productivity and efficiency in production processes. An important point in deploying Data Matrix codes is their recognition and decoding. In this paper is presented a computationally efficient algorithm for locating Data Matrix codes in the images. Image areas that may contain the Data Matrix code are to be identified firstly. To identify these areas, the thresholding, connected components labelling and examining outer bounding-box of the continuous regions is used. Subsequently, to determine the boundaries of the Data Matrix code more precisely, we work with the difference of adjacent projections around the Finder Pattern. The dimensions of the Data Matrix code are determined by analyzing the local extremes around the Timing Pattern. We verified the proposed method on a testing set of synthetic and real scene images and compared it with the results of other open-source and commercial solutions. The proposed method has achieved better results than competitive commercial solutions.
关键词:adaptive thresholding; connected component labelling; data matrix code; finder pattern; timing pattern